Partnerships
Real estate agents and broker networks supply high-quality listings and pay for premium exposure and tools, with over 80% of property searches starting online in 2024, driving platform monetization. Partnerships secure steady listing inflow and broad market coverage across regions and niches. Joint marketing and data-sharing raise lead quality and conversion rates. Long-term contracts stabilize multi-year revenue visibility.
Property developers and landlords supply Scout24 with new-build and rental pipelines, feeding a marketplace that reached over 15 million monthly users in 2024. Preferred partner programs offer bulk listings, co-branded project pages and prioritized placement to scale visibility. Co-marketing campaigns accelerate absorption and lower vacancy cycles, while API integrations sync availability, pricing and updates in real time.
Banks, mortgage brokers and insurers enable integrated pre-qualification, tailored mortgage offers and bundled insurance directly in ImmoScout24 flows, leveraging 12M+ monthly users to convert high-intent shoppers. Affiliate and lead-referral agreements monetize traffic, with platform partnerships contributing roughly 20% of proptech monetization in 2024 industry estimates. Co-branded calculators and mortgage widgets boost stickiness and trust, while continuous data feedback loops refine credit scoring and risk targeting in near real time.

Resources
Strong brand equity drives organic traffic and trust with seekers and professionals, supporting ImmoScout24's c.70% share of Germany's online property listings in 2024 and high repeat-visit rates. Recognition lowers acquisition costs and boosts conversion for both lead generation and listings. Leadership attracts premium inventory from top brokers and enables pricing power on subscriptions and ad formats, lifting ARPU and margin improvements.
Scout24’s two-sided network — roughly 17 million monthly users in 2024 — and tens of thousands of professional sellers generate deep liquidity, shortening time-to-sale and boosting deal flow. Verified, up-to-date listings lift conversion by increasing buyer trust and reducing wasted inquiries. Strong network effects improve matching quality as more buyers and sellers concentrate on the platform. Scale advantages and data-driven insights strengthen defensibility against smaller rivals.
Historical listings, behavioral signals and pricing data feed Scout24’s analytics to generate market context and trend forecasts; these inputs power models for automated valuations, lead scoring and fraud detection. Advanced machine learning models translate patterns into actionable metrics that differentiate client decisions across sales, sourcing and marketing. Robust governance and compliance frameworks ensure responsible, auditable usage of proprietary data.

Cost Structure
Engineering, product and design salaries form the bulk of Scout24’s fixed tech costs, while platform hosting, CDNs and third‑party tools drive variable spend. Scout24 increased tech and product investment in 2024 per investor updates to accelerate platform features and monetization. Continuous R&D and ongoing security, reliability and DevOps spending remain material line items.
SEO, SEM and brand campaigns drive the bulk of traffic to Scout24’s portals, with organic search typically accounting for ~50% of visits and paid channels ~20% (2024 trends); dedicated sales teams and commission structures support B2B growth, contributing roughly 30% of enterprise contract wins; events and content programs nurture demand and supply ~15–20% of qualified leads; retention programs target churn below 5% annually.
Third-party data licenses and enrichment services are material to Scout24, driving recurring spend for property and vehicle datasets and marketplaces; in 2024 these inputs continued to represent a significant share of platform OPEX. Moderation and KYC tools materially reduce fraud and chargebacks, supporting trust across ImmobilienScout24 and AutoScout24. Legal, privacy, and regulatory costs rose in 2024 with GDPR and sector rules, while reporting and audits add steady overhead for compliance and investor reporting.

Revenue Streams
Recurring professional subscriptions from agents, brokers and landlords form a stable revenue base, with tiered plans offering listing quotas and analytics tools; long-term contracts in 2024 increased visibility and retention, while add-ons (premium placement, leads) lifted ARPU by over 10% year-on-year.
Pay-per-listing or monthly upgrades for featured spots on Scout24 drive premium placements that improve ranking, branding and exposure, with featured ads commonly delivering up to 3x more views and ~30% higher lead rates. Dynamic pricing adjusts fees by demand and location to capture peak willingness-to-pay. These offerings are high-margin and scalable, contributing materially to platform monetization and recurring revenue.
Qualified buyer and renter leads are packaged and sold to real estate professionals, driving scalable revenue through pay-per-lead and subscription models.
Referral fees from banks, insurers, and movers create ancillary income streams, with partners paying for converted leads and cross-sell opportunities.
Performance-based pricing aligns incentives—clients pay for outcomes—while high-intent traffic from property searchers maximizes yield per visit.
Advertising and targeted media
Advertising and targeted media at Scout24 monetizes display, native and sponsorship inventory across AutoScout24 and ImmobilienScout24, leveraging first-party intent data to target audiences and improve campaign ROI.
Demand is diversified via programmatic auctions and direct deals with brands; seasonal peaks (spring listings, year-end moves) historically lift CPMs significantly in core markets.
In 2024 digital advertising remained a material revenue pillar, contributing about 30% of platform ad-related income and showing double-digit YoY CPM growth during peak seasons.
SaaS tools, data products, and reports
SaaS tools, data products, and reports monetize through fees for CRM integrations, analytics dashboards, and automated valuations, plus enterprise data subscriptions for developer access and financial feeds; custom insights and partner APIs enable premium, value-based pricing that captures demonstrable ROI.
